Wie kann man in Vim die Zeilennummern anzeigen?

Melden
  1. Standardmäßiges Anzeigen von Zeilennummern in Vim
  2. Relative Zeilennummern als Alternative
  3. Zeilennummern dauerhaft einstellen
  4. Fazit

Vim ist ein sehr mächtiger und vielseitiger Texteditor, der vor allem bei Programmierern und Systemadministratoren sehr beliebt ist. Eine häufige Anforderung ist es, sich innerhalb einer Datei die Zeilennummern anzeigen zu lassen, damit man sich besser orientieren kann. In diesem Artikel wird ausführlich erklärt, wie Sie in Vim die Zeilennummern anzeigen lassen können, welche Varianten es gibt und wie Sie die Einstellungen dauerhaft vornehmen können.

Standardmäßiges Anzeigen von Zeilennummern in Vim

Um in Vim die Zeilennummern einzublenden, kann man den Befehl :set number verwenden. Sobald man diesen Befehl eingibt und mit Enter bestätigt, werden links neben dem Text die entsprechenden Zeilennummern angezeigt. Dies erleichtert die Navigation im Dokument erheblich, beispielsweise beim Springen zu einer bestimmten Zeile.

Relative Zeilennummern als Alternative

Es gibt auch die Möglichkeit, nicht absolute, sondern relative Zeilennummern darzustellen. Hierbei zeigt Vim für jede Zeile die Entfernung von der aktuellen Cursorposition an. Das ist besonders hilfreich für Befehle, die sich auf eine bestimmte Anzahl von Zeilen relativ zur aktuellen Position beziehen, wie etwa das Bewegen oder Löschen von Zeilen.

Der Befehl für relative Nummern lautet :set relativenumber. In vielen Fällen können beide Modi kombiniert werden, sodass für die aktuelle Zeile die absolute Nummer und für die anderen Zeilen die relativen Nummern angezeigt werden.

Zeilennummern dauerhaft einstellen

Wenn Sie die Zeilennummern nicht nur temporär in einer Sitzung aktivieren möchten, können Sie die Einstellungen in der Vim-Konfigurationsdatei .vimrc hinterlegen. Dort fügen Sie einfach die Zeile set number ein, um die absolute Nummerierung bei jedem Start von Vim zu aktivieren. Möchten Sie stattdessen relative Nummern, verwenden Sie set relativenumber. Für eine Kombination beider Varianten können Sie beide Befehle eintragen.

Fazit

Das Anzeigen von Zeilennummern in Vim ist sehr einfach und steigert die Übersichtlichkeit beim Arbeiten mit längeren Dateien oder beim Programmieren deutlich. Mit den Befehlen :set number und :set relativenumber stehen Ihnen einfache Möglichkeiten zur Verfügung, die Zeilennummerierung je nach Bedarf anzupassen. Um die Einstellung dauerhaft zu machen, genügt ein Eintrag in der .vimrc-Datei.

0

Kommentare